He CANNOT be entered in P&Y or B&C because he has shed his antlers. You can enter the sheds in the shed division.

That being said, why bother killing him after he has shed. You can get a cape and mount the antlers. I am never that hard up for meat. He walks if he has shed no matter what tags I have left!!!
